نظم التشغيل - الجزء الأول 2026 CS340
This course explores the fundamentals of operating systems, covering key topics like process management, memory allocation, etc.
-
- CH1: Introduction
-
CH2: Process Concepts
- Process Concept 28:19
- Process Scheduler 35:12
- Interprocess Communication 10:54
-
CH3: Threads
- Threads Concept 27:33
-
CH4: CPU Scheduling
- Basic Concepts 21:46
- Scheduling Criteria 10:50
- (1) FCFS Algorithm 25:25
- (2) SJF Algorithm 25:32
- (3) Priority Scheduling 25:14
- (4) RR Scheduling 19:12
- (5) MLQ Scheduling 25:37
- (6) MLFQ Scheduling 33:22
- Multi-processor Scheduling 07:08
-
CH5: Deadlock
- The Deadlock Problem 18:46
- Deadlock Characterization 10:22
- Resource-Allocation Graph 26:27
- Methods for Handling Deadlocks 06:41
- Deadlock Prevention 19:23
- CH6: Synchronization
-
Tutorials and Revisions
- Tutorial 1 01:02:29
- CH2: Tutorial and Revision 41:51
- CH4: Tutorial and Revision pt.1
- CH4: Tutorial and Revision pt.2 01:01:39
- Summaries
- Labs
-
Previous Exams
- Quiz 1 - 2025 2nd Term 28:09
- Quiz 1 - 2024_2025 1st Term 22:56
- Quiz 1 - 2023_2024 Online 35:47
- Quiz 1 - 2023 05:40
- Quiz 1 - 2022 08:17
- Quiz 1 - 2021 07:42
- Mid1 2024-2025 1st Term 29:11
- Mid1 2022 31:14
- Mid1 paper and online 01:04:18
- Mid 1 - 2025 2nd Term 33:44
-
Lab Previous Exams
- Lab Quiz 1 - 2026 14:10
- Lab Quiz 1 -2025 2nd Term 19:54
- Lab Quiz 1 16:04
- Lab Quiz 1 - Write 22:41
- Lab Quiz 1 - MS-DOS 20:06
- This course explores the fundamentals of operating systems, covering key topics like process management, memory allocation, etc.
-
-
Student feedback
5Course Rating
250 SAR
Lectures
64 Videos
Duration
21:38:24
Material
29 Files
Assignments
Yes, Completely
Labs
Yes, Completely
Project
Explanation, No implementation
Certificate
Not Applicable
Reviews (0)
Real reviews from real students.
No reviews yet.